🌟🐦 Huge shoutout to Val for helping our 4K students make pinecone bird feeders yesterday! It was the perfect way to wrap up our Winter Animals unit. Val showed the kids pictures of different birds and feeders, and explained how tough it can be for birds to find food in winter. Each student took one home, and we even made extras for school! Thanks, Val, for such a fun and educational day! 🌲❄️ #WinterFun #LittleBirdHelpers

On the evening of January 8, 2025, four 5th grade students participated in the annual Trempealeau County Conservation Speaking Contest. Students researched and wrote 3-5 minute speeches that they presented in front of a 3-person panel in the Trempealeau County Board Room in Whitehall. All four competed in the elementary division for 5th and 6th graders. All 4 students performed very well and made it very hard for the judges to determine a winner. In the end, the results were as follows: 1st: Sophie Schaefer (6th Grade)—"Root for Change: We Need Trees!" 2nd: Lillian Triana (5th Grade)—"Bee Aware!" 3rd: Annalise Tabbert (5th Grade)—"The Little Monster" (emerald ash borer) 4th: Jett Leffelman (5th Grade)—"A Quarter Century of CWD in Wisconsin" 5th: Jessica Kitchner (5th Grade)—"Decrease in Butterflies in Our Area" Congratulations to all participants!
